I did a few things to get the bookings. 1 was that I had a drawing for everyone who agreed to book from the show, for the cheese grater from my kit, since I had one already. I will be doing the same thing for the next 4 shows, as I have ALOT of PC products that are duplicates.

Also, I just explained the wonderful benefits to having a show. Pampered Chef sells itself, and I pointed out that if some items are beyond your budget, that is no reason not to have it, EARN IT!! Then I went into my "single mother" spiel, about how when my girls were young, and I had no extra money, I stocked my kitchen with PC products just by having shows in my home. Most of the time I could not afford to take advantage of the 1/2 price bonus's I earned, just took free product. I went accross the street the other night to a single mom, and just told her my story. She booked, and she is very excited about earning things she cannot afford to buy.
